Childhood of Seraphim of Sarov

The proposed prayer rule was literally suffered by the elder himself, who had to endure and endure much. And only by the will of God remain alive. The tempter of Seraphim of Sarov once became even the Devil himself, but more about this later.

So Prokhor Moshnin was born (that was his name in the world) on July 19, 1754 (or 1759) in Kursk in the merchant family of the Moshnins. His father was engaged in various construction contracts, including the construction of churches.

Today in Kursk, the church is preserved - the Sergiev-Kazan Cathedral, which began to build the father of Seraphim of Sarov, but soon he died, and the leadership of the construction of the church took up his wife. Prokhor once was at the construction site with his mother and accidentally, on a childish prank, fell from a high bell tower. However, surprisingly, he remained alive, since God set a completely different fate for him. Today, in this temple, it is at this place that there stands a monument to St. Seraphim of Sarov.

Adolescence

From a young age, Prokhor tried to fulfill a prayer rule for lay people. He often visited church services, learned to read and write. He frequently read the Lives of the Saints and the Gospel aloud to their peers. When he became very ill, his mother put his head to the icon of the Sign of the Blessed Virgin Mary - and the boy received healing from her. Soon, very young Prokhor wanted to become a novice in the monastery. His own mother blessed him and gave him a crucifix, with which he did not leave his whole life. Today it is kept by nuns in Serafimo-Diveevsky monastery.

Monasticism

Soon Prokhor makes a pilgrimage to the Kiev-Pechersk Lavra. There he receives the blessing of the elder Dositheus for service and goes to the Holy Assumption Sarov desert. Upon the arrival of Prokhor in the monastery, Pakhomi's father assigned him a confessor-the elder Joseph. Prokhor with great pleasure and diligence fulfilled all his duties and with great zeal read the prayer rule.

Then, following the example of other monks, he wanted to retire into the woods for Jesus' prayer. To this, the elder Joseph was blessed.

After a while, the young novice began to torment the dropsy. The disease did not let him go for a long time, but he did not want to see doctors and completely surrendered to the will of God. And then one day after the sacrament at night he saw the Theotokos with John the Theologian and the Apostle Peter. She poked him in the side with her baton and the liquid from it immediately flowed out. From that moment Prokhor went on to recover.

Enoch

After eight years in the Sarov convent, Prokhor becomes a monk named Seraphim. He began to live in a cell in a forest near the monastery. It was then that he got involved in a monastic feat, in particular a corporal feat, because he wore clothes the same as in the summer, that in the winter. His meager subsistence he had earned himself in the woods, since he basically kept a fast. He slept little, spending time in constant prayer and fulfilling the daily prayer rule, rereading the Gospel and the patristic writings.

He reached such a spiritual development that he often saw church services in the church services assisting the service of the Holy Angels. And once he even saw Jesus Christ himself, who entered the image at the Royal Gates. After such visions, Seraphim of Sarov prayed even more intensely. With the blessing of the abbot of the monastery of Father Isaiah, he decides on a new feat - he leaves for several kilometers to a forest desert cell. He comes to the monastery only on Saturdays.

Testing

At the age of 39, he becomes a priest. Father Seraphim devotes himself almost entirely to prayer and can even lie still for a long time. Over time, again with the blessing of the abbot of the monastery, he ceased to receive visitors, the path to it was almost overgrown, only wild animals, whom he liked to treat with bread, could wander there.

Such feats of Father Seraphim did not like the Devil. He decided to send robbers on him, who came to him and began to demand money from the poor old man. These uninvited guests beat Father Seraphim almost to death. He was strong enough to fight back, but decided not to shed blood, because he lived according to the commandments, his faith in the Lord was strong. Money they did not find, and therefore, ashamed, they left home. The brothers were shocked when they saw the wounded father. But the doctor was not needed for the old man, since the Queen of Heaven herself healed him, once again appearing to him in a dream.

Empanelity

After a few months, Father Seraphim returned to his deserted cell. For 15 years of asceticism, he was constantly in Bogomysliya and for that he was gifted with the gift of foresight and miracles. When the old father greatly weakened, he returned to the monastery and began to receive visitors, to whom he treated with great respect and spoke only "Joy".

It is thanks to Seraphim of Sarov that we have a short prayer rule that enables every Orthodox Christian to always be closer to God at any moment.

His real brainchild was the Diveevo Convent, whose development was inspired by the Mother of God herself.

Before his death, the Monk Seraphim of Sarov communed and, kneeling before his beloved icon of the Virgin, "Tenderness", departed peacefully to the Lord. This happened in 1833.

The canonization of the holy relics of St. Seraphim of Sarov took place on August 1 in 1903. In this process, the Russian Tsar Nicholas II participated.

The prayer rule of Seraphim of Sarov

His spiritual children Seraphim of Sarov asked to pray tirelessly, believing that prayer is necessary to them as air. He said that you must pray in the morning and in the evening, before and after work, and at any time. However, it is difficult for ordinary parishioners to read all the necessary numerous prayers, this is not the case for everyone and time will suffice because of the constant worldly fuss and employment. That's why, so that less people sin, and there were special short prayer rules of Seraphim of Sarov.

The morning and evening prayer rule

These prayers do not require any special effort and hard work. But, according to the saint, these rules will become an anchor, reliably restraining the ship of life on the raging waves of everyday problems. Daily fulfilling these rules, you can achieve a high spiritual development, since it is prayer is the main essence of the foundation of Christianity.

The morning prayer rule says that every believing person, waking up in the morning, must first cross himself three times and in a certain place before the icons, three times to read the prayer "Our Father", three times "Theotokos, rejoice" and once "The Symbol of Faith". And then you can calmly start your business. During the day, too, we must periodically turn to God with prayer: "Lord Jesus Christ, Son of God, have mercy on me a sinner." If around people, then say the words: "Lord have mercy."

Rule of Seraphim of Sarov

And so before dinner, and before him exactly the morning prayer rule should be repeated. After dinner, a short prayer is read, "Blessed Virgin Mother of God, save me a sinner." This prayer should be read periodically until the evening. In seclusion from everyone read "Lord Jesus Christ, Mother of God, have mercy on me a sinner."

At the end of the day, the evening prayer rule is read. The text of his prayers absolutely coincides with the morning prayers. And then, three times christened, you can go to bed. This is the prayer rule for beginners from the most holy elder Seraphim of Sarov.

Designation of prayers

The prayer "Our Father" is the word of the Lord, placed by Him in the pattern. Prayer "Virgin Mary, rejoice" became the greeting of the Archangel to the Theotokos. Prayer "The Symbol of Faith" is a dogma.

However, along with these prayers, it is necessary to pronounce others as well as to read the Gospel, the laudatory canons and the akathists.

Our wise elder Seraphim advised, if because of the strong employment at work there is no possibility to adequately read the prayers, then this can be done when walking, and in any case, even lying down. The main thing is always to remember his words: "Anyone who calls on the name of the Lord will be saved."
